Swayambhunath Stupa Experience

Kathmandu Delights: 7-Hour Day Tour of Heritage Sites - Swayambhunath Stupa Experience

Perched atop a hill, the Swayambhunath Stupa, often referred to as the Monkey Temple, offers visitors a breathtaking panoramic view of the Kathmandu Valley. As you climb the 365 steps, colorful prayer flags flutter in the breeze, and cheeky monkeys playfully interact with travelers. This UNESCO World Heritage Site is a significant symbol of Buddhist culture, inviting reflection and reverence.

Discovering Patan Durbar Square

Kathmandu Delights: 7-Hour Day Tour of Heritage Sites - Discovering Patan Durbar Square

Patan Durbar Square, a vibrant hub of history and architecture, showcases the best of Newari craftsmanship. Visitors can marvel at the intricate woodwork and stunning stone carvings that adorn the structures.

The square features several architectural marvels, including the magnificent Krishna Temple and the Golden Temple, each telling its own story. While wandering through the square, it’s essential to take a moment to visit the Patan Museum, where the rich history of the region comes alive.

For practical advice, wear comfortable shoes as you’ll be walking on cobblestone paths. Also, don’t forget your camera—this UNESCO World Heritage Site offers countless photo opportunities that capture the essence of Nepal’s cultural heritage.

Pashupatinath Temple Insights

Kathmandu Delights: 7-Hour Day Tour of Heritage Sites - Pashupatinath Temple Insights

The Pashupatinath Temple stands as a pivotal spiritual landmark in Nepal, drawing both pilgrims and travelers alike. Nestled on the banks of the Bagmati River, this UNESCO World Heritage Site is dedicated to Lord Shiva.

Visitors can witness vibrant rituals, including daily prayers and elaborate cremation ceremonies, reflecting profound Hindu beliefs about life and death. It’s essential to be respectful while exploring; wearing modest clothing is a must.

Photography is allowed, but it’s best to avoid capturing the cremation ghats out of respect. Guided tours provide rich insights into the temple’s history and significance.

Don’t miss the chance to observe the sacredness of the site and perhaps catch a glimpse of the resident sadhus, or holy men, adding to the temple’s mystique.

Exploring Boudhanath Stupa

Kathmandu Delights: 7-Hour Day Tour of Heritage Sites - Exploring Boudhanath Stupa

After soaking in the spiritual atmosphere at Pashupatinath Temple, visitors can head to the Boudhanath Stupa, one of the largest and most significant stupas in the world.

This iconic site serves as a vibrant center for Tibetan Buddhism in Nepal. As they stroll around the stupa, they’ll notice the rhythmic spinning of prayer wheels and the serene faces of pilgrims deep in meditation.

It’s a perfect spot to absorb the local culture, with friendly vendors selling traditional crafts and snacks.

Don’t miss exploring the nearby monasteries, where monks share insights about their practices.

For an authentic experience, visitors should join the locals in circumambulating the stupa while taking in the stunning architecture and lively atmosphere.
